Smaller Airports with Scheduled Flights / Air Taxi Service ...
- Tallahassee Rgnl. (TLH/KTLH)
(44 miles [70.8 km] to the west southwest)
- Southwest Georgia Rgnl. (ABY/KABY)
(65 miles [104.6 km] to the north northwest)
- Gainesville Rgnl. (GNV/KGNV)
(108 miles [173.8 km] to the southeast)
- Dothan Rgnl. (DHN/KDHN)
(113 miles [181.9 km] to the west northwest)
